I am new here too. I have been living with the bipolar diagnoses for 18 years. The treatment you are receiving from your husband sounds very similar to the way I treated my first husband. I had a manic episode that involved delusions and became convinced that I had to divorce my husband. He is a very kind but naive person and could not comprehend what I was going through. Unfortunately the divorce proceeded and we went our separate ways. I got medication and therapy and felt a deep sense of regret over the loss of the marriage. I can say that medication completely altered my frame of mind. I believe if your husband is properly medicated he may alter his behavior.
Ultimately, you have to take care of yourself and you sound like you are in a great deal of pain. I hope that your situation is settled for the best of both of you.
